Combines traditional cloud GPUs via Google Cloud and AWS with 30,000+ community-operated edge nodes for flexible compute.
Supply-demand driven pricing where node operators set rates and users select GPUs based on availability and cost.
Routes heavy training jobs to cloud/datacenter GPUs and distributes parallelizable inference across edge nodes.
Reroutes jobs to healthy nodes if a community node goes offline mid-task, ensuring workload continuity.
Docker-based job execution with Jupyter Notebook and SSH access for flexible development environments.
On-demand model inference APIs and dedicated AI model serving with support for popular generative AI models.

Flexible pricing with no upfront commitment
Save up to 72% with 1 or 3-year commitments
Up to 90% savings for interruptible workloads
Cost savings for existing Windows Server and SQL Server licenses
Dynamic pricing set by node operators in a supply-demand GPU marketplace.
Hourly billing with no long-term commitments or contracts required.
